Mls. Silva et al., ANTIGENIC COMPONENTS OF EXCRETORY-SECRETORY PRODUCTS OF ADULT FASCIOLA-HEPATICA RECOGNIZED IN HUMAN INFECTIONS, The American journal of tropical medicine and hygiene, 54(2), 1996, pp. 146-148

The antigenic components of excretory-secretory products (ESP) of adul
t worms of Fasciola hepatica were revealed by sodium dodecyl sulfate-p
olyacrylamide gel electrophoresis and Western blot analysis using sera
from 20 patients infected with F. hepatica. Sera from 184 other paras
itic infections and 20 healthy volunteers were also analyzed. It was f
ound that the ESP were composed of more than 11 polypeptides; five com
ponents detected in fascioliasis sera had molecular weights of 12.4, 1
6.4, 19.4, 25, and 27 kilodaltons (kD). Only the 25- and 27-kD compone
nts were recognized by all 20 fascioliasis sera. Using the ESP as anti
gen, it was possible to perform an en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ay w
ith a sensitivity of 95% and a specificity of 97%. Sera from other par
asitic infections had antibodies to antigenic components with apparent
molecular weights of 37, 38.4, 52, 57, 63, 73, 87, 109, and 116 kD th
at were also found in sera from fascioliasis patients. These findings
suggested that the 25- and 27-kD antigenic components may be sensitive
and specific for the diagnosis of human fascioliasis.
